People normally do this by scanning a 10mW 832nm laser with a mirror, according to Dan Gelbart in https://www.youtube.com/watch?v=0MtRxX0crjU. The lecture is 77 minutes, covering nonlinear junction detectors, digital calipers, the US-embassy bug in Russia, laser microphones bounced off windows, and geometric errors from material relaxation. The bit about camera detectors is close to the end. Works for eyeballs too.
Lensless sensors (for example, using compressed sensing, or Hadamard shadow masks) can presumably defeat this, but also, watching from far enough away should defeat it. Hard to do that inside a pervert's AirBNB, though.
